# TODO this is a first draft - should be optimised later
function _hist2d_counts(x::AbstractVector{Union{T,Missing}}, y::AbstractVector{Union{S,Missing}}, k_x, k_y, _f_x, _f_y; default_method)::Vector{Tuple} where {T<:Real} where {S<:Real}
if k_x === nothing || k_y === nothing
count_missing = count(val->ismissing(coalesce(_f_x(val[1]), _f_y(val[2]))), zip(x,y))
count_nonmissing = length(x) - count_missing
k_x = something(k_x, default_method(count_nonmissing))
k_y =something(k_y, default_method(count_nonmissing))
end
max_val_x = IMD.maximum(_f_x, x)
min_val_x = IMD.minimum(_f_x, x)
max_val_y = IMD.maximum(_f_y, y)
min_val_y = IMD.minimum(_f_y, y)
any(isequal.(max_val_x, (missing, NaN, Inf, -Inf))) && throw(ArgumentError("x shouldn't be all missing or contains any NaN or infinite value"))
any(isequal.(min_val_x, (missing, NaN, Inf, -Inf))) && throw(ArgumentError("x shouldn't be all missing or contains any NaN or infinite value"))
any(isequal.(max_val_y, (missing, NaN, Inf, -Inf))) && throw(ArgumentError("y shouldn't be all missing or contains any NaN or infinite value"))
any(isequal.(min_val_y, (missing, NaN, Inf, -Inf))) && throw(ArgumentError("y shouldn't be all missing or contains any NaN or infinite value"))
(isequal(max_val_x, min_val_x) || isequal(max_val_y, min_val_y)) && throw(ArgumentError("at least two different values are needed"))
# do we need these?
min_val_act_x = min(min_val_x, max_val_x)
max_val_act_x = max(min_val_x, max_val_x)
min_val_act_y = min(min_val_y, max_val_y)
max_val_act_y = max(min_val_y, max_val_y)
# we only support length for creating bins
bins_x = range(min_val_act_x, max_val_act_x, length=k_x)
bins_y = range(min_val_act_y, max_val_act_y, length=k_y)
counts = zeros(Int, k_x, k_y)
for (val_x, val_y) in zip(x, y)
if !ismissing(val_x) && !ismissing(val_y)
counts[searchsortedfirst(bins_x, _f_x(val_x)), searchsortedfirst(bins_y, _f_y(val_y))] += 1
end
end
counts[2, :] += counts[1, :]
counts[:, 2] += counts[:, 1]
counts[1, :] .= 0
counts[:, 1] .= 0
bins_1 = collect(bins_x)
bins_2 = collect(bins_y)
binsx_start = bins_1[1:end-1]
binsx_end = bins_1[2:end]
binsy_start = bins_2[1:end-1]
binsy_end = bins_2[2:end]
lx = length(binsx_start)
ly = length(binsy_end)
tuple.(repeat(binsx_start, outer=ly), repeat(binsx_end, outer=ly), repeat(binsy_start, inner=lx), repeat(binsy_end, inner=lx), vec(counts[2:end, 2:end]))
end
"""
Heatmap(args...)
Represent a Heatmap (2D Histogram) with given arguments.
$(print_doc(HEAT_DEFAULT))
"""
mutable struct Heatmap <: SGMarks
opts
function Heatmap(; opts...)
optsd = val_opts(opts)
cp_HEAT_DEFAULT = update_default_opts!(deepcopy(HEAT_DEFAULT), optsd)
if (cp_HEAT_DEFAULT[:x] == 0 || cp_HEAT_DEFAULT[:y] == 0)
throw(ArgumentError("Heatmap plot needs both x and y keyword arguments"))
end
new(cp_HEAT_DEFAULT)
end
end
# Heatmap graphic produce a heatmap plot
# It requires both x or y keyword arguments
# It needs the input data be processed before being sent to vega
function _push_plots!(vspec, plt::Heatmap, all_args; idx=1)
# check if the required arguments are passed / create a new ds and push it to out_ds
new_ds = _check_and_normalize!(plt, all_args)
_add_legends!(plt, all_args, idx)
data_csv = tempname()
filewriter(data_csv, new_ds, mapformats=all_args.mapformats, quotechar='"')
push!(vspec[:data], _prepare_data("heatmap_data_$idx", data_csv, new_ds, all_args))
opts = plt.opts
s_spec =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ec[:type] = "group"
s_spec[:clip] = something(opts[:clip], all_args.opts[:clip])
s_spec_marks =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:type] = "rect"
s_spec_marks[:from] = Dict(:data => "heatmap_data_$idx")
s_spec_marks[:encode]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:opacity] = Dict{Symbol, Any}(:value => opts[:opacity])
if opts[:tooltip]
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:tooltip] = Dict{Symbol, Any}(:field=>:__bin__counts__)
end
# s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:stroke] = Dict(:value => opts[:outlinecolor])
# s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:strokeWidth] = Dict(:value => opts[:outlinethickness])
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:fill]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:fill][:scale] = "color_scale_$idx"
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:fill][:field] = :__bin__counts__
addto_color_scale!(vspec, "heatmap_data_$idx", "color_scale_$idx", :__bin__counts__, false; color_model=opts[:colormodel])
if opts[:x2axis]
_scale_x = "x2"
_which_ax = 2
else
_scale_x = "x1"
_which_ax = 1
end
if opts[:y2axis]
_scale_y = "y2"
_which_ay = 4
else
_scale_y = "y1"
_which_ay = 3
end
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:x]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:x2]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:x][:scale] = _scale_x
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:x2][:scale] = _scale_x
addto_scale!(all_args, _which_ax, new_ds, "__bin__x__start__")
addto_scale!(all_args, _which_ax, new_ds, "__bin__x__end__")
addto_axis!(vspec[:axes][_which_ax], all_args.axes[_which_ax], opts[:x])
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:y]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:y2] = Dict{Symbol,Any}()
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:y][:scale] = _scale_y
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:y2][:scale] = _scale_y
addto_scale!(all_args, _which_ay, new_ds, "__bin__y__start__")
addto_scale!(all_args, _which_ay, new_ds, "__bin__y__end__")
addto_axis!(vspec[:axes][_which_ay], all_args.axes[_which_ay], opts[:y])
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:x][:field] = "__bin__x__start__"
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:x2][:field] = "__bin__x__end__"
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:y][:field] = "__bin__y__start__"
s_spec_marks[:encode][:enter][:y2][:field] = "__bin__y__end__"
s_spec[:marks] = [s_spec_marks]
push!(vspec[:marks], s_spec)
end
